Output 381f65217aa4c2966c19e1ca4ab6ca3ccfad4f178b598a887f50988856437617:10

value
662746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e37959f734e0719ba78477e732a95d0d7c9d872c OP_EQUAL
address
3NRngjYVSWSbMdnnXMNGvua8CBSkvuvMAz
transaction
381f65217aa4c2966c19e1ca4ab6ca3ccfad4f178b598a887f50988856437617
confirmations
105643
spent
true